How to use it
Finding Your Proposal List
Go to the Proposals page. You'll see a list of all the proposals you've created.
Each proposal will have a title, a recipient, a date, and a status.
Identifying Tracking Statuses
Take a look at the 'Status' column for each proposal. Here's what you'll typically see:
Draft: You're still working on it and haven't sent it yet.
Sent: You've sent it. Tracking begins.
Viewed: Your potential guest has opened the link to your proposal. You'll often see the date and time it was first viewed.
Accepted: Your guest has officially accepted your proposal.
Declined: The guest has formally declined the offer.
Diving Deeper
For more detail, click the title of any proposal. This opens the proposal's page, where you may find a 'Tracking History' section with a timeline of activities.
Tips
Follow up promptly when a proposal has been 'Viewed'. Send a friendly email or make a quick call within a day or two.
Analyse acceptance rates to see which types of proposals are most successful.
Use views as a temperature check. Multiple views may indicate a highly interested guest.
Stay organised by regularly checking your 'Proposals' list.
